How much does it cost to rent an apartment in San Clemente?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| San Clemente Studio Apartments | $2,043 | $1,177 | $2,450 |
| San Clemente 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,117 | $1,135 | $4,950 |
San Clemente 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,670 | $1,513 | $6,461 |
| San Clemente 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,749 | $2,950 | $9,000 |
| San Clemente 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,675 | $3,650 | $3,700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om San Clemente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om San Clemente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in San Clemente is $3,670.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om San Clemente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in San Clemente is a 1,273 square feet unit starting from $3,150 at San Onofre 1.
What is the average size for San Clemente 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in San Clemente is currently 1,194 sq ft.
